Cargill Strategic Pricing Analyst Chocolate in Singapore, Singapore

Job Purpose and Impact

Note: Role allows rotation between Tuas and Telok Ayer office.

The Strategic Pricing Analyst Chocolate will support the development, implementation, execution and continuous monitoring and review of Strategic Pricing activities in the Asia-Pacific region. The Strategic Pricing Analyst works closely with the margin manager to ensure product and service profitability. In addition to sound analytical and deduction skills, he/she should have strong communication and relationship building skills to collaborate across numerous functions including: sales, customer service, trading, logistics and finance. The ideal candidate would need to be organized and be able to migrate efficiently through complex systems and data (eg. JDE, Tableau, Power BI etc).

Key Accountabilities

  • Supports Margin Manager in profit maximisation and capacity management work by managing stakeholders in Sales, Operations and Supply Chain.

  • Analyze competitors, customers’ information and trends to identify potential threats and opportunities and collaborate with cross functional teams of commercial, finance and operations to deliver insights, strategies and decisions.

  • Maintain in depth knowledge of the designated markets, pricing and product strategies and perform research to determine competitive price positioning, willingness to pay and feature function comparison.

  • Maintains accurate pricing data in order management for Revenue and profitability forecast

  • Perform ongoing analysis and running of pricing model as well as analyze profitability and profitability leakage

  • Synthesize moderately complex data from multiple sources and transform it into insights, analysis and reports to support decisions required for the company to maintain a competitive position in the market

Qualifications

M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S

  • Bachelor’s degree in business, analytics or statistics or equivalent with minimum 3 years related work experience

  • Experience in Cocoa / Chocolate preferred

  • Strong business acumen

  • Advanced spreadsheet and presentation skills using related applications
